Abstract :
Single crystalline ternary ZnxCd1−xS nanocombs, which have ‘comb’ shaped teeth on one side, have been synthesized by a one-step metallo-organic chemical vapor deposition process at a low temperature of 420 °C. The asymmetric growth behavior of the nanocombs is likely to be induced by the polarization of the c-plane. Because of the uniform structure and perfect geometrical shape, the nanoteeth could be potentially useful as nanocantilever arrays for nanosensors and nanotweezers.
